To move forward decisively, conduct a focused visit with Terri and the care team. Inquire about daily schedules, staffing levels across shifts, and how care plans are customized and updated as needs evolve. Probe for specifics on licensing, incident reporting, and how crises or hospital discharges are managed. Ask whether a trial stay or short-term arrangement is possible to gauge fit, and discuss transition planning, medication management, and any memory-care considerations if applicable. Description

Nurturing Alliance Personal Care Home is an assisted living community located in the beautiful city of Savannah, Georgia. Our community offers a range of amenities and care services to ensure that our residents feel comfortable and well taken care of.

Our dining room provides a cozy and inviting space for residents to enjoy delicious meals prepared by our talented staff. Each room in our community is fully furnished, offering a comfortable and home-like environment for our residents.

Outside, we have a garden where residents can spend time enjoying the fresh air and beautiful surroundings. In addition, we provide housekeeping services to maintain a clean and tidy living space for our residents.

We understand that moving can be stressful, which is why we offer move-in coordination to help ease the transition for new residents. We also provide Wi-Fi/high-speed internet access and telephone services so that residents can stay connected with their loved ones.

When it comes to care services, we offer assistance with activities of daily living such as bathing, dressing, and transfers. Our staff also coordinates with health care providers to ensure that each resident receives the necessary medical attention they need. We specialize in diabetes diets and are able to accommodate special dietary restrictions.

Transportation is made easy with our arrangement for medical transport as well as transportation to doctors' appointments. Our community is conveniently located near cafes, pharmacies, physicians, and restaurants.

At Nurturing Alliance Personal Care Home, we believe in providing a nurturing environment where our residents' needs are met. With scheduled daily activities, our residents have the opportunity to engage in meaningful experiences while creating lasting friendships within our community.
